Tabla de contenido:
- Paso 1: proporcione un vocabulario simple
- Paso 2: preparar un espacio de trabajo para los cálculos
- Paso 3: seleccione una palabra aleatoria de la lista
- Paso 4: repita para otros tipos de palabras
- Paso 5: Forma una oración
- Paso 6: Bonito
- Paso 7: más, más, más
- Paso 8: más frases mejores
- Paso 9: Hacer trampa
Video: Robot "MadLib" usando Excel: 9 pasos
2024 Autor: John Day | [email protected]. Última modificación: 2024-01-30 08:44
¿Recuerdas madlibbing con tus amigos? Una persona proporcionaría los sustantivos y los verbos, y la otra persona proporcionaría una oración con espacios en blanco para completarlos. La parte divertida fue ver las conexiones inesperadas.
Este instructivo le mostrará cómo usar Microsoft Excel para crear muchas oraciones completamente aleatorias, usando las palabras que proporcione. Aquí está la frase que mi hoja de cálculo acaba de generar para mí: "El muñeco triste le grita enojado al chico blandito". y estoy bastante sorprendido de saberlo. ¿Qué te dirá tu hoja de cálculo?
Paso 1: proporcione un vocabulario simple
Comience abriendo un documento en blanco en Microsoft Excel. Estoy usando Excel 2007, pero también puede hacer esto en versiones anteriores. Todo es lo mismo.
Solo tendrá que preocuparse por tres áreas de la hoja de cálculo. 1) La celda activa será donde ocurrirá la mayor parte de la escritura. 2) Puede ver la fórmula de la celda activa también en la barra de fórmulas. Es posible que prefiera escribir las cosas allí, si su hoja de cálculo se está llenando demasiado. 3) Usaremos dos hojas en el libro de trabajo. Puede alternar entre ellos haciendo clic en estas pestañas. … Comenzando con la hoja de trabajo Hoja1, haga una tabla de palabras, como se muestra. Para empezar, solo usaremos sustantivos, verbos y adjetivos. Y solo cuatro de cada uno. Más adelante te mostraré cómo agregar más.
Paso 2: preparar un espacio de trabajo para los cálculos
Hay algunas fórmulas que tendremos que escribir, así que ve a la hoja2 haciendo clic en la pestaña de la hoja2 en la parte inferior de la ventana. Comienza etiquetando filas y columnas. 1) La columna B está etiquetada como adjetivo, la columna C es sustantivo y la columna D es verbo 2) la fila 2 será para conteos. Etiquetalo '#'. 3) Las filas 2 y 3 serán para palabras aleatorias. Etiquételos ahora también … Nuestra primera fórmula devolverá el número de palabras en una columna en particular. 1) En la celda B3 (columna B, fila 3), escriba esta fórmula EXACTAMENTE (copie y pegue desde esta página, si es posible) = CONTAR (Hoja1! A: A) -1 Esto le dice a Excel, "vaya a 'hoja1' y cuente todas las celdas que no están en blanco en la columna A. Reste una de eso" (para la etiqueta en la primera fila). 2) Copie esta fórmula y péguela en C3. Cambie la parte A: A a B: B3) Copie a D3 y cambie A: A a C: C
Paso 3: seleccione una palabra aleatoria de la lista
Es hora de seleccionar nuestra primera palabra aleatoria. 1) En la celda B3, ingrese esta fórmula EXACTAMENTE = INDIRECTO (DIRECCIÓN (INT (RAND () * Hoja2! $ B $ 2) +2, 1, 1, VERDADERO, "hoja1")) 2) Pegue esta fórmula en B4, como bueno… Si está interesado (y no es necesario que lo esté), hay cuatro llamadas de función en esta línea. Están anidados juntos para que el interior se haga primero.1) RAND () genera un número aleatorio entre 0 y 1. Ese número se multiplica por el número de palabras en la lista. Por ejemplo, si el número aleatorio es.314159 y el número de palabras es 10, entonces la fórmula devolvería 3.14159.2) INT recorta cualquier parte fraccionaria. En este caso, 3.14159 se convertiría simplemente en 3.3) ADDRESS crea una referencia de celda. El primer parámetro es la fila y el segundo parámetro es la columna. Aquí, la fila sería 3 (del número aleatorio), y la columna sería la primera columna: columna A. También pedimos que esta sea una dirección en 'hoja1'. 4) INDIRECTO va a la referencia de celda creada en paso 3 y encuentra la palabra allí. Sí, es algo complicado. No me senté un día y uní todas estas fórmulas. Aprendí cada uno de ellos por separado durante mucho tiempo, para resolver problemas muy diferentes. Pasó un tiempo antes de que me diera cuenta de que podía usarlos juntos de una manera divertida. Porque tengo un cerebro extraño. Sigamos adelante.
Paso 4: repita para otros tipos de palabras
Ahora que estamos generando adjetivos aleatorios con éxito, podemos hacer las mismas fórmulas para sustantivos y verbos.
1) Copie la fórmula de B3 a C3 2) Cambie $ B $ 2 a $ C $ 2 3) Cambie 1 a 2 4) Copie C3 a C4… 1) Copie la fórmula de C3 a D3 2) Cambie $ C $ 2 a $ D $ 2 3) Cambie 2 a 3 4) Copie D3 a D4 Ahora debería tener una tabla con un montón de palabras al azar. (¿Ha notado que las palabras aleatorias cambian cada vez que cambia algo más en la hoja de cálculo? Esa es la genialidad de la función RAND. Se actualiza cada vez que se cambia algo en la hoja de cálculo.:-)
Paso 5: Forma una oración
Ahora queremos unir estas palabras en una oración. Escriba esta fórmula EXACTAMENTE, en la celda A7: = "El" & B3 & "" & C3 & "" & D3 & "el" & B4 & "" & C4Cuando presione retorno, verá su primera oración aleatoria. ¿Quieres otro? Presione 'CTRL + ='. (Esa es la tecla CTRL, más el '=', al mismo tiempo). ¡Continúe! La aleatoriedad nunca se detiene. ¿Cómo funciona? Excel mezcló todo en esa línea. La palabra "The" se rompió en la palabra aleatoria en la celda B3, que se rompió en el espacio ("") y en la celda C3, etc. Como una acumulación de cinco palabras, fusionada con esos símbolos y símbolos (&).
Paso 6: Bonito
Cuando le muestre esto a sus amigos, probablemente querrá ocultar todos los cálculos y fórmulas.
Puede ocultar esas filas, 1) haga clic en las etiquetas de las filas y arrastre para seleccionar varias filas 2) haga clic con el botón derecho en la fila para obtener un menú emergente 3) elija Ocultar en el menú emergente … También puede encontrar muchas opciones de formato de texto en la barra de herramientas de Inicio. He perdido muchas horas de mi vida, desplazándome por la interminable lista de fuentes que vienen con Microsoft Office. En este ejemplo, seleccioné 'Jokerman'. También puede agregar algunas instrucciones para que sus amigos sepan qué hacer.
Paso 7: más, más, más
Más aleatoriedad resulta de una lista más larga de palabras.
Agregue tantas palabras como pueda pensar. Pide palabras a tus amigos. Agréguelos a las listas en sheet1. …
Paso 8: más frases mejores
Los buenos escritores saben que, mientras que las oraciones cortas llaman su atención, las oraciones más largas con más modificadores crean un estado de ánimo. Puede agregar más tipos de palabras y cambiar la estructura para obtener oraciones más elaboradas y extravagantes. PRIMERO, agregue otra columna a la hoja1. En este ejemplo, agregaré algunos adverbios a mi oración. … SEGUNDO, también agregue otra columna a la hoja2 (es posible que tenga que 'mostrar' estas filas, si las ocultó en un paso anterior. Haga clic con el botón derecho donde deberían estar las filas para obtener el menú emergente. Seleccione Mostrar.) Copie las fórmulas de las columnas anteriores, y ajustar como antes. Por lo tanto, E3 debería ser: = COUNTA (Sheet1! D: D) -1E4 y E5 debería ser: = INDIRECT (ADDRESS (INT (RAND () * Sheet2! $ E $ 2) +2, 4, 1, TRUE, "sheet1")) … FINALMENTE, agrega la (s) nueva (s) palabra (s) a tu oración. Puse mi nuevo adverbio delante del verbo, como corresponde. = "El" & B3 & "" & C3 & "" & E3 & "" & D3 & "el" & B4 & "" & C4 Tenga cuidado de unir todo con símbolos de unión (&). También asegúrese de que haya espacios ("") entre las palabras.
Paso 9: Hacer trampa
Aquí hay algunas ideas más. ¿Por qué no modificar la hoja de cálculo para generar:
- titulares de los tabloides, como "¡Jennifer Aniston y Bigfoot anuncian planes para casarse!"
- nueva serie de televisión, como 'perro biónico viaja en el tiempo a la misteriosa isla de las supermodelos'
- excusas, como 'Mi perro biónico que viaja en el tiempo se comió mi tarea'.
- poesía romántica, como 'Te amo más que a una misteriosa isla de supermodelos'
:-) Fin. Y ahora, como recompensa por su atención continua, por favor encuentre adjunta mi hoja de cálculo madlib final. Todas las fórmulas YA ESTÁN ESCRITAS, pero es posible que deba ser arreglada. Agregue comentarios si está confundido acerca de alguno de los pasos. Lo explicaré o arreglaré el paso.
Recomendado:
Control llevado en todo el mundo usando Internet usando Arduino: 4 pasos
Control dirigido en todo el mundo usando Internet usando Arduino: Hola, soy Rithik. Vamos a hacer un led controlado por internet usando tu teléfono. Vamos a usar software como Arduino IDE y Blynk. Es simple y si lo lograste puedes controlar tantos componentes electrónicos como quieras Cosas que necesitamos: Hardware:
Envío de datos de sensores inalámbricos de temperatura y vibración a Excel usando Node-RED: 25 pasos
Envío de datos de sensores inalámbricos de temperatura y vibración a Excel usando Node-RED: Presentamos el sensor de temperatura y vibración inalámbrico industrial IoT de largo alcance de NCD, con un alcance de hasta 2 millas mediante el uso de una estructura de red de malla inalámbrica. Al incorporar un sensor de temperatura y vibración de precisión de 16 bits, este dispositivo trans
Cómo buscar cosas en Google Chrome usando macros de Microsoft Excel (NO SE REQUIEREN CONOCIMIENTOS DE CODIFICACIÓN): 10 pasos
Cómo buscar cosas en Google Chrome usando macros de Microsoft Excel (NO SE REQUIEREN CONOCIMIENTOS DE CODIFICACIÓN): ¿Sabía que puede agregar fácilmente una función de búsqueda a su hoja de cálculo de Excel? ¡Puedo mostrarle cómo hacerlo en un par de sencillos pasos! Para hacer esto, necesitará lo siguiente: Una computadora - (¡COMPRUEBE!) Microsoft Excel Google Chrome instalado en usted
HC - 06 (Módulo esclavo) Cambio de "NOMBRE" sin uso "Monitorear Arduino serial" que "Funciona fácilmente": ¡Manera impecable!: 3 pasos
HC - 06 (Módulo esclavo) Cambiando "NOMBRE" sin usar "Monitor Serial Arduino" … que "Funciona fácilmente": ¡Manera impecable!: Después de " Mucho tiempo " intentando cambiar el nombre en HC - 06 (módulo esclavo), utilizando " monitor serial del Arduino, sin " Éxito ", encontré otra manera fácil y ahora estoy compartiendo! ¡Que se diviertan amigos
Hacer un Madlib con el Bloc de notas: 6 pasos
Hacer un Madlib con el Bloc de notas: este instructivo le enseñará cómo hacer un Madlib con el bloc de notas